Understanding the Importance of Insurance Coverage for USA Visitors:
Healthcare costs in the United States can be exorbitant, and unexpected medical emergencies or accidents can quickly drain your finances. It is crucial to have insurance coverage to safeguard against unforeseen circumstances and ensure access to quality healthcare during your visit.
Types of Insurance Coverage for USA Visitors:
a) Travel Medical Insurance:
Travel medical insurance provides coverage for medical expenses, emergency medical evacuation, trip interruption, and other benefits specific to travelers. It is designed to protect you from the high costs associated with healthcare services in the USA.
b) Visitor Health Insurance:
Visitor health insurance is designed specifically for non-US residents visiting the country. It offers coverage for medical expenses, hospitalization, prescription drugs, emergency dental treatment, and more. This type of insurance provides peace of mind by minimizing out-of-pocket expenses for unexpected medical needs.
Factors to Consider when Choosing Affordable Insurance:
a) Coverage Limits:
When comparing insurance options, pay attention to the coverage limits for various medical services, emergency medical evacuation, and repatriation. Make sure the coverage aligns with your anticipated needs.
b) Deductibles and Co-payments:
Consider the deductible and co-payment amounts associated with the insurance plan. Higher deductibles may result in lower premiums, but you should evaluate your ability to cover out-of-pocket expenses in case of a claim.
c) Pre-existing Conditions:
If you have any pre-existing medical conditions, check whether the insurance plan provides coverage for them. Some plans may have exclusions or waiting periods for pre-existing conditions.
d) Network Providers:
Ensure that the insurance plan has a network of healthcare providers, hospitals, and clinics in the areas you plan to visit. Accessing network providers can save you money on medical services.

Duration of Coverage:
Consider the length of your stay in the United States when choosing insurance coverage. Some insurance plans offer coverage for short-term visits, while others provide coverage for extended periods. Understanding the duration of coverage will help you select a cost-effective option that aligns with your travel plans.
Additional Coverage Considerations:
Trip Cancellation or Interruption:
In addition to medical coverage, consider adding trip cancellation or interruption coverage to protect your investment in case unforeseen circumstances force you to cancel or cut short your trip.
Baggage and Personal Belongings:
Insurance plans that offer coverage for lost, stolen, or damaged baggage and personal belongings can provide an extra layer of security during your visit.
